Senior Draftsperson - TGW - Drafting

Be among the first applicants.
Toro Aluminum
Vaughan
CAD 60,000 - 80,000
Be among the first applicants.
4 days ago
Job description

Friday, March 28, 2025

JOB SUMMARY

The Drafting Supervisor is responsible for working closely with the Senior Drafting Manager – East/West for overseeing the drafting process, ensuring quality work is delivered within set timelines and budgets. They will lead a team of drafters, providing guidance and direction on project requirements, design standards and technical specifications. Is the ‘go to’ person on the management of day to day projects and helps drive performance improvement by mentoring and coaching others.

DIRECT AND/OR INDIRECT REPORTS

Team of Job Captains and Drafters (Junior to senior levels)

MAJOR RESPONSIBILITIES/ACCOUNTABILITIES

Management/Supervision/Leadership

  1. Provide direction and support to the Project Management team ensuring key deliverables are achieved within the required timelines.
  2. Engage, motivate and give positive praise and recognition and establish a culture of inclusivity and respect.
  3. Provides mentoring support and guidance to junior members of the team, developing their knowledge and understanding.
  4. Schedules and assigns the workload of others ensuring project deliverables are achieved reporting any performance concerns or issues to the Senior Drafting Manager East/West.

Health and Safety

  1. Creates and influences the safety culture by leading by example as a mentor and model.
  2. Promotes safe working practices and demonstrates compliance with legislation.
  3. Address safety issues and concerns promptly ensuring employees follow policies and procedures.
  4. Reports any known workplace hazards or violations of the Act to the Senior Drafting Manager East/West.

Technical/Function

  1. Clarifies roles and responsibilities within the team to ensure all drafting accountabilities are understood by all and resources are allocated accordingly.
  2. Oversees the Document and Project Review Processes for Shop Drawings and facilitates team progress with assigned tasks.
  3. Provides comments to Architectural Drawing Review within specified timescales.
  4. Review architectural page turner and shop drawings page turner.
  5. Plan, oversee and execute drafting projects, including managing timelines, and resources.
  6. Ensure compliance with all relevant regulations, codes and standards.
  7. Review and approve all drafted plans and designs at each stage of the process and ensure these are to the required standards/technical specifications. Address any concerns or issues promptly.
  8. Coordinate with other departments and stakeholders to ensure effective communication and collaboration and understanding of requirements, milestones, deadlines, etc.
  9. Provide input and recommendations on project/drafting scope and feasibility.
  10. Develop and implement strategies for continuous improvement of drafting processes and systems.
  11. Stay up to date with industry trends, software, and technologies proposing new ideas and concepts with the aim of driving departmental performance and standards of improvement.
  12. Chair and participate in drafting meetings ensuring project deliverables and milestones are closely monitored and obstacles/issues addressed promptly.
  13. Provide expert advice and guidance on drafting principles and be the ‘go to’ expert in this field.
  14. Build strong relations with internal and external clients, customers, contractors, architects, etc by working collaboratively.

Internal/External Customer Service

  1. Work closely with key departments (e.g. Project Management Team) to ensure projects are delivered on time.

EDUCATION AND QUALIFICATIONS

  1. Bachelor's degree in architecture, engineering or a related field.

EXPERIENCE

  1. Minimum of 5 years of drafting experience, including.
  2. Window-wall and Unitized wall experience is a strong asset.
  3. Proficiency in drafting software: Strong ability to work with AutoCAD and Revit and ability to read blueprints.

SKILLS

  1. Excellent communicator verbally and in written form.
  2. High level of attention to detail/detail orientated.
  3. Excellent organizational and problem-solving skills (ability to manage multiple projects simultaneously).
  4. Familiarity with relevant regulations, codes and standards.
  5. Ability to prioritize work and meet deadlines.
  6. Strong Technical skills.
  7. Team player and mentor.
  8. Ability to work independently as well as a team member.
  9. Physical Demands: This job may require prolonged periods of sitting, standing, and working on a computer. Some travel may be required to visit job sites or attend meetings.

DEMONSTRATE COMPANY VALUES

  1. Do what you say – act with integrity so our customers and internal partners trust us to deliver results.
  2. Get it done – find solutions to ensure the job gets done right.
  3. Be better every day – take pride and be passionate about improving our business, safety, and quality and strive to be the best.
  4. Think big picture – think long-term, be strategic and have a vision. Your investment in our business is critical to our success.
  5. Build strong relationships – value our employees, suppliers, and advisors as an essential part of our business. Develop and maintain strong relationships with our customers, contractors and stakeholders.
Get a free, confidential resume review.
Select file or drag and drop it
Avatar
Free online coaching
Improve your chances of getting that interview invitation!
Be the first to explore new Senior Draftsperson - TGW - Drafting jobs in Vaughan